Immerse yourself in the enchanting world of Maurice Ravel's piano masterpieces with this captivating album, released in 1971 under the Eterna label. This collection showcases Ravel's extraordinary talent and his unique contributions to classical and neoclassical music, all performed with exquisite skill by Monique Haas.
The album opens with "Jeux d'eau," a sparkling and evocative piece that sets the tone for the rest of the collection. Following this is the iconic "Gaspard de la nuit," a challenging yet rewarding work that includes the haunting "Ondine," the eerie "Le Gibet," and the virtuosic "Scarbo." Each piece is a testament to Ravel's ability to convey deep emotion and vivid imagery through his music.
The second half of the album is dedicated to "Miroirs," a suite of five pieces that offer a kaleidoscope of moods and textures. From the delicate "Noctuelles" to the playful "Alborada del gracioso," and the serene "La vallée des cloches," each piece is a jewel in its own right. The album concludes with the ethereal "Une barque sur l'océan," leaving the listener with a sense of tranquility and wonder.
